If you’re concerned your phone is collecting outrageous amounts of data which could be applyd for nefarious purposes, you’re not alone – and, in fact, you’re not wrong, either. Reporters have just revealed how simple it is to conduct sophisticated reconnaissance missions on EU Commissioners with nothing but openly traded information from data brokers.
A coalition of journalists applyd preview data from a data broker to ascertain the exact location of hundreds of EU officials – with over 5,800 location pings inside the European Parliament from 756 devices.
The collective was able to establish ‘shiftment profiles’ for EU employees, in which shiftments could be traced between official hoapplying back and forth between EU parliament, supermarkets, restaurants, religious buildings, parties, and more.

For most of us, this news will come as an unsurprising but abhorrent invasion of personal digital privacy and as a warning about the scale of mass surveillance carried out by private companies in the name of advertising (or perhaps something even more sinister).
But, for EU officials there is very real additional consideration of safety and security.
Most of us will not have to plan our escape routes in case of a political attack, nor do we have to take mitigating actions to protect ourselves from espionage campaigns – but this research reveals EU officials may have to receive more serious about data privacy – quick.
These are not abstract threats, either. The advent of the war in Ukraine has seen a spike in espionage campaigns tarreceiveing western allied states, and Chinese hackers tarreceive European diplomats with Windows zero-day flaw in cyber-based intrusions.
Officials are being tarreceiveed, and technology and the commercialization of personal data has built this much simpler for foreign or domestic adversaries.
